Yes, UPES School of Law provides placements for Bachelor of Laws (LL.B.) with a placement record of 80% (approx.). The highest CTC offered is 9.5LPA and the top 10% average CTC is 8.2LPA.

No, there is no entrance exam required for admission to Bachelor of Laws (LL.B.) at UPES School of Law. The eligibility criteria include a minimum of 50% marks at Higher and Senior Secondary level (X, XII) and Graduation in any stream.

The UPES School of Law offers admission to the Bachelor of Laws (LL.B.) course on the basis of minimum 50% marks at Higher and Senior Secondary level (X, XII) and Graduation in any stream.
